diff --git a/src/icons/icons.qrc b/src/icons/icons.qrc
index ed9e50b30..797e31c17 100644
--- a/src/icons/icons.qrc
+++ b/src/icons/icons.qrc
@@ -122,7 +122,8 @@
images/options_edit_16px@2x.png
images/partial.png
images/path.png
- images/pause.png
+ images/pause_16px.png
+ images/pause_16px@2x.png
images/photo.png
images/polygon.png
images/prev_topic_24px.png
@@ -161,15 +162,18 @@
images/ruler.png
images/debug.png
images/bug.png
- images/run.png
- images/runthis.png
+ images/run_16px.png
+ images/run_16px@2x.png
+ images/runthis_16px.png
+ images/runthis_16px@2x.png
images/save.png
images/save_all.png
images/select.png
images/setup_16px.png
images/setup_16px@2x.png
images/singlestep.png
- images/stop.png
+ images/stop_16px.png
+ images/stop_16px@2x.png
images/techs.png
images/text.png
images/textdocumenticon.png
diff --git a/src/icons/images/pause.png b/src/icons/images/pause.png
deleted file mode 100644
index 0d1a15b5e..000000000
Binary files a/src/icons/images/pause.png and /dev/null differ
diff --git a/src/icons/images/run.png b/src/icons/images/run.png
deleted file mode 100644
index 84bd4b505..000000000
Binary files a/src/icons/images/run.png and /dev/null differ
diff --git a/src/icons/images/runthis.png b/src/icons/images/runthis.png
deleted file mode 100644
index ca2842d93..000000000
Binary files a/src/icons/images/runthis.png and /dev/null differ
diff --git a/src/icons/images/stop.png b/src/icons/images/stop.png
deleted file mode 100644
index 4707c4d78..000000000
Binary files a/src/icons/images/stop.png and /dev/null differ
diff --git a/src/lay/lay/MacroEditorDialog.ui b/src/lay/lay/MacroEditorDialog.ui
index 3621b1fe6..d02f93ee8 100644
--- a/src/lay/lay/MacroEditorDialog.ui
+++ b/src/lay/lay/MacroEditorDialog.ui
@@ -399,7 +399,7 @@ p, li { white-space: pre-wrap; }
- :/run.png:/run.png
+ :/run_16px.png:/run_16px.png
F5
@@ -419,7 +419,7 @@ p, li { white-space: pre-wrap; }
- :/runthis.png:/runthis.png
+ :/runthis_16px.png:/runthis_16px.png
Shift+F5
@@ -442,7 +442,7 @@ p, li { white-space: pre-wrap; }
- :/stop.png:/stop.png
+ :/stop_16px.png:/stop_16px.png
true
@@ -462,7 +462,7 @@ p, li { white-space: pre-wrap; }
- :/pause.png:/pause.png
+ :/pause_16px.png:/pause_16px.png
Ctrl+F5
diff --git a/src/lay/lay/layMacroEditorDialog.cc b/src/lay/lay/layMacroEditorDialog.cc
index dd1f2725f..a09fef3d6 100644
--- a/src/lay/lay/layMacroEditorDialog.cc
+++ b/src/lay/lay/layMacroEditorDialog.cc
@@ -3434,7 +3434,7 @@ MacroEditorDialog::do_update_ui_to_run_mode ()
if (t != m_tab_widgets.end ()) {
int index = tabWidget->indexOf (t->second);
if (index >= 0) {
- tabWidget->setTabIcon (index, QIcon (QString::fromUtf8 (m_in_exec ? (m_in_breakpoint ? ":/pause.png" : ":/stop.png") : ":/run.png")));
+ tabWidget->setTabIcon (index, QIcon (QString::fromUtf8 (m_in_exec ? (m_in_breakpoint ? ":/pause_16px.png" : ":/stop_16px.png") : ":/run_16px.png")));
}
}
}
@@ -3481,7 +3481,7 @@ MacroEditorDialog::editor_for_macro (lym::Macro *macro)
int index = tabWidget->addTab (editor, tl::to_qstring (macro->name ()));
tabWidget->setTabToolTip (index, tl::to_qstring (macro->summary ()));
if (macro == mp_run_macro) {
- tabWidget->setTabIcon (index, QIcon (QString::fromUtf8 (m_in_exec ? (m_in_breakpoint ? ":/pause.png" : ":/stop.png") : ":/run.png")));
+ tabWidget->setTabIcon (index, QIcon (QString::fromUtf8 (m_in_exec ? (m_in_breakpoint ? ":/pause_16px.png" : ":/stop_16px.png") : ":/run_16px.png")));
}
bool f = m_add_edit_trace_enabled;
@@ -3736,7 +3736,7 @@ MacroEditorDialog::set_run_macro (lym::Macro *m)
if (t != m_tab_widgets.end ()) {
int index = tabWidget->indexOf (t->second);
if (index >= 0) {
- tabWidget->setTabIcon (index, QIcon (QString::fromUtf8 (":/run.png")));
+ tabWidget->setTabIcon (index, QIcon (QString::fromUtf8 (":/run_16px.png")));
}
}